Further to the recent announcement for Industrial Action the Postal Executive have agreed to set up a helpline for any enquiries relating to the dispute.
It will be our intention to place the telephone numbers in the next letter sent to all members’ home addresses. The correspondence will make it quite clear that any initial enquiries should be raised with their respective branches, and branch officials should manage and respond to any enquiries wherever possible. However, CWU headquarters fully appreciate that there will be times when branches are unable to provide answers to certain questions therefore the helpline will be put in place to assist members and branches wherever possible.
During the Industrial Action called on Friday, 29th June the helpline will be covered by members of the Postal Executive on Thursday 28th, Friday 29th June and Monday, 2nd July.
